Output 8f62d332462ed5c82df81b2c2449bd543bf7a9300e8de0e5040cfef2a3399257:0

value
25205086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81733295f89f37f3a5e172c542ce5eb83c29f62 OP_EQUAL
address
3JUQ3o2b8EH6CoVevUhNJyTsVyYDEpA1qV
transaction
8f62d332462ed5c82df81b2c2449bd543bf7a9300e8de0e5040cfef2a3399257
confirmations
332650
spent
true